What’s going on with Floyd Mayweather? Latest felony charges explained

Floyd Mayweather is facing two felony charges in Las Vegas after prosecutors alleged he used a $200,000 check with insufficient funds to purchase an Audemars Piguet watch from luxury resale store Gold and Beyond. The former boxing champion appeared through legal counsel during a court hearing this week and is scheduled for another hearing in September. The criminal case adds to a growing list of legal and financial disputes involving Mayweather, including tax issues, civil lawsuits and business-related litigation, even as he remains scheduled to compete in an exhibition match against Mike Zambidis in Greece later this month.
